About GDI: The Global Development Incubator, Inc. (GDI Africa), is a non-profit organization independently incorporated in Kenya in April 2017 and legally registered under the Non-Governmental Organizations Coordination Act of Kenya. GDI Africa is governed by a locally constituted Board and directly employs over fifty staff across the country and Africa region. GDI is renowned for launching and operationalizing initiatives aimed at systemic and scaled change. GDI's mission is to bring together ideas, leaders, and capital to build and scale the next generation of social solutions. Key areas of implementation include youth employment, economic inclusion for the extreme poor, gender and PWD inclusion, financing for smallholder farmers, mental health, green jobs and financing, MSME development and sustainable economic development. GDI Africa works deep in the community with partners and directly with participants in all initiatives, building capacity and ensuring the voices and stories of communities, especially women, are incorporated in all of GDI's work.
